GlusterFS搭建使用

 

 

测试环境:

三台服务器ubuntu:18.04

<1>9.1.1.128

<2>9.1.1.129

<3>9.1.1.131

1.添加映射地址【每个服务器执行】:

命令:vim /etc/hosts

追加内容:

9.1.1.128 Manager

9.1.1.129 Agent01

9.1.1.131 Agent02

2.添加必要储存库:

apt-get install software-properties-common

add-apt-repository ppa:gluster/glusterfs-3.13

3.更新:

apt-get update --fix-missing

 

4.安装[服务端默认也安装了客户端]:

apt-get install glusterfs-server

 

5.开启设置开机自启:

sudo systemctl start glusterd

sudo systemctl enable glusterd

配置GlusterFS

6.首先要做的是创建一个可信任的池。 这是在Manager上使用以下命令完成的

sudo gluster peer probe Agent01

sudo gluster peer probe Agent02

你应该立即看到peer probe:success。

你可以使用以下命令检查对等体的状态:

sudo gluster peer status

你应该看到已添加2个对等体:

 

 

 

7.创建目录:

sudo mkdir -p /home/data

8.创建卷:

sudo gluster volume create v01 replica 3 transport tcp Manager:/home/data Agent01:/home/data Agent02:/home/data forc

9.检查卷的状态

gluster volume info v01

10.开启卷:

gluster volume start v01

 

11.创建安装点

sudo mkdir -p /home/data2/

 

12.使用以下命令安装分布式glusterfs卷:

sudo mount -t glusterfs Manager:/v01 /home/data2/

 

13.使用以下命令检查卷:

df -h /home/data2/

 

 

14.我们的卷已经安装

要在重新引导时进行此挂载,请将以下行添加到gfs03/etc/fstab文件中:

Manager:/v01 /home/data2 glusterfs defaults,_netdev 0 0

现在,如果必须重新启动服务器,GlusterFS卷将自动挂载。

 

posted @ 2019-05-09 15:03  Cool_Yang  阅读(709)  评论(0编辑  收藏  举报